Understanding Single Port Network Cards

What is a Single Port Network Card?

A single port network card is a type of network interface card (NIC) that provides a single network connection to a server or workstation. These cards are designed to offer high-speed network connectivity, ensuring efficient data transfer and communication within a network. Single port network cards are commonly used in environments where bandwidth, reliability, and low latency are critical.

The Power of Solid State Drives (SSDs)

What are Solid State Drives?

Solid state drives (SSDs) are storage devices that use flash memory to store data. Unlike traditional hard disk drives (HDDs), SSDs have no moving parts, which makes them faster, more durable, and energy-efficient. SSDs are available in various form factors and capacities, making them suitable for a wide range of applications.

Advantages of Solid State Drives

  1. Speed and Performance: SSDs are significantly faster than HDDs in terms of data read and write speeds. This results in quicker boot times, faster application load times, and improved overall system performance.

  2. Durability and Reliability: With no moving parts, SSDs are less prone to mechanical failure. They can withstand shocks and vibrations, making them more reliable and durable than traditional HDDs.

  3. Energy Efficiency: SSDs consume less power compared to HDDs, which translates to lower energy costs and reduced heat generation. This is particularly beneficial in data centers where energy efficiency is a major concern.

  4. Compact Form Factor: SSDs are available in smaller form factors, such as M.2 and U.2, allowing for more efficient use of space within servers and workstations. This is especially useful in environments with limited physical space.

Enhancing Storage Performance with SSD RAID Controllers

Introduction

In the realm of data storage and management, speed, reliability, and capacity are paramount. SSD RAID controllers are the linchpin that brings these attributes together, delivering exceptional performance for demanding applications. Whether you're running a data-intensive enterprise or optimizing a personal system, understanding SSD RAID controllers can help you make informed decisions to enhance your storage infrastructure.

What is an SSD RAID Controller?

A RAID controller is a hardware or software component that manages multiple disk drives in a RAID configuration. RAID configurations can distribute data across multiple drives to improve performance, increase storage capacity, and provide redundancy in case of drive failures. When combined with SSDs (Solid State Drives), RAID controllers leverage the high-speed and reliability of SSDs to offer superior storage solutions.

Benefits of SSD RAID Controllers

1. Performance Boost

SSDs are known for their fast read/write speeds compared to traditional HDDs (Hard Disk Drives). By combining SSDs in a RAID setup, the performance is amplified even further. RAID 0, for example, stripes data across multiple SSDs, enabling simultaneous read/write operations that significantly reduce latency and increase throughput. This makes SSD RAID controllers ideal for applications requiring high-speed data access, such as video editing, gaming, and database management.


2. Enhanced Reliability and Redundancy

Data integrity is crucial for both businesses and individual users. RAID configurations like RAID 1 (mirroring) and RAID 5 (striping with parity) provide redundancy by storing data across multiple drives. In the event of a drive failure, data can be reconstructed from the remaining drives, minimizing downtime and preventing data loss. SSD RAID controllers ensure that the reliability of SSDs is maximized, providing a robust storage solution.

3. Scalability

As data storage needs grow, scalability becomes a vital factor. SSD RAID controllers allow for easy expansion by adding more SSDs to the array. This flexibility ensures that storage infrastructure can scale with the increasing data demands without compromising performance or reliability.

Popular RAID Configurations for SSDs

RAID 0 (Striping)

RAID 0 stripes data across multiple SSDs, providing excellent performance improvements. It’s ideal for tasks requiring high-speed data access but does not offer redundancy. Therefore, it is suited for non-critical applications where performance is the primary concern.

RAID 1 (Mirroring)

RAID 1 creates an exact copy (or mirror) of data on two or more SSDs. This configuration provides redundancy, ensuring that if one drive fails, the data remains accessible on the other drive. While it does not enhance performance like RAID 0, it offers superior data protection, making it suitable for critical applications.

RAID 5 (Striping with Parity)

RAID 5 offers a balance between performance and redundancy. It stripes data across multiple SSDs while also storing parity information. If a drive fails, the parity data can be used to reconstruct the lost data. This configuration is commonly used in enterprise environments where both speed and data integrity are essential.

RAID 10 (1+0)

RAID 10 combines the benefits of RAID 0 and RAID 1 by striping and mirroring data. This setup offers high performance and redundancy but requires at least four SSDs. It is ideal for high-performance applications that also require robust data protection.
